electric aerial motor doesn't stop to work!
Hi,
in my 1992 XJ12 jag yesterday antenna motor started to make problems... When I turned off radio, the electric antenna motor properly started but the antenna stayed up - the problem is that the motor didn't stop - just continued to work. I had to cut the big lift relay to stop it. I have opened the antenna motor - inside there is another (smaller) relay that (it seems to me) regulates little connectors. When I unclasp that little connector with my fingers, the motor stops... So - any idea what should I do? In my opinion that little relay does not work - is that relay kind of general relay that is used also in other devices (and could be bought) or is special relay just for that particular motor? Any suggestions? Thanks, Cene |

RE: electric aerial motor doesn't stop to work!
If it's a 92 XJ12 then it has the Series 3 style motor. No toothed cable to replace. Unfortunately, that's only sold as a complete unit.
